  3. Advice & experience sought please. My 2013 XF Portfolio has only rear parking sensors and I wish to purchase front sensors. Several main dealers say they can't fit them though one will at £400+ and mobile fitters will do the job for around £200. I would like an LED/distance display mounted above the steering column below the speedo with an on-off switch. Has anyone experience of after market and/or mobile fitters. I am most worried that they would not fit wiring neatly enough etc. I would be very grateful for any advice. Regards
